How they compare
Colombia currently reports 0.0012 m3 per person against 0.0012 m3 per person in South Sudan, a difference of 0 m3 per person.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 13 shared years of data; in 2012 it was Colombia ahead.
Colombia ranks 132nd and South Sudan ranks 134th of 184 countries.
Colombia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Colombia | South Sudan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010s | 0.0011 m3 per person | 0.0001 m3 per person | 0.001 m3 per person | Colombia |
| 2020s | 0.001 m3 per person | 0.0005 m3 per person | 0.0004 m3 per person | Colombia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
